## Planner Regression Endpoint

The /planner/replay endpoint on Querybee re-executes a captured query plan against the previous optimizer build, letting on-call compare costs when a regression is suspected. Pass the plan hash and a target build tag; output includes estimated versus actual row counts. Replays run on the shadow cluster and never touch production data. Requests must authenticate against the shadow gateway using the key below.

gateway credential: kto23_LX9A4ys6i4nzHtpOLNLodKK

## Approvals — Notification Fan-out Backpressure (Signalhatch)

When fan-out queues exceed the backpressure threshold, delivery slows automatically. Support must not raise the threshold or flush queues without approval. Temporary rate exceptions require a logged ticket and expire after 24 hours. Any permanent change to backpressure limits requires written approval from the person named below.

named custodian: Oliath Ralax

Subject: Key rotation — Usersplit migration service

Hi all, and welcome to those who joined this sprint. As part of splitting the user module out of the Cobblestone monolith, the extraction service (Usersplit) talks to the internal Membrane API to copy account records in batches. We rotated its credentials this morning because the previous key predated the migration freeze. Please update any local configs before tomorrow's batch run; stale keys will cause silent skips, not errors. The new key for the Membrane API follows.

API key for yahig-tadup: kto7_ubizbYm

Ticket: Fleet fuel-usage report failing in staging for Haulrick Logistics. Root cause: the Drivline reporting service is pointed at the prod warehouse but using staging credentials, so nightly aggregation aborts. Fix is a one-line env change before Thursday's release cut. The corrected key for the reporting service goes on the following line.

sealed setting: LEDGER_TOKEN13=b4a1a6f880cb4